hey everyone, Boreta here

We've been working on a new photo app called Mirrorgram for the past few months. if you have been wondering how we create all those mirrored images, well... now you know :)

Mirrogram is going live on the App Store on October 11, and it’s the result of a collaboration with our friends at StageBloc. (theglitchmob.com runs on StageBloc). Our friend Joyce who drives designs for The Glitch Mob did the graphics, and Momo the Monster who ran visuals for the last Glitch Mob tour worked on the app as well. 

I came up with the idea of making Mirrorgram on the Drink The Sea tour. we’re all big iphone nerds and started geeking pretty hard on iphone photo apps as a way to explore cities and kill time on the bus. I’ve had a long-running fascination with symmetry and photo editing, and i realized there was no simple way to create symmetrical images on my iPhone. At the time, i was doing it with a lot of apps that weren’t meant for that, and wanted an easier way for me and my friends to make trippy, mirrored images.

one of the coolest things is how it allows you to see stuff around you in a new way. some of the most interest images i have taken come from mundane stuff like buildings, sand, plants, or the airport:

I’m super excited for the app launch next week. in a way, making Mirrorram has been a lot like creating new music -- it’s all about creating something that hasn’t been heard or seen before.
